The Experience

Event Concept

The Century Ball has been 100 years in the making, a party like no other, to celebrate the AGA’s 100th Anniversary. We proposed an exquisite evening that revels in revolutionary art movements from the 20th Century; celebrating the audacious visions that dared to challenge the norm.

Event Highlights

Guests were treated to an exquisite VIP dining experience featuring a chef-curated menu of small plates and craft cocktails—marking the first time in AGA history that guests were invited to dine privately within the gallery spaces. Surrounded by stunning works of art, the evening offered a truly immersive, once-in-a-lifetime setting.
Three art movements—Pop Art, Surrealism, and Abstract Expressionism—informed every touchpoint of the event, from the custom four-course plated tasting menu to signature cocktails and mocktails, curated visual art installations, centrepieces, music, and live performances.

This exclusive, elevated experience activated the entire building, celebrating the AGA as a source of pride for its founders, supporters, and key stakeholders.

Guests were welcomed by a surrealism-inspired storytelling host who guided them through the unfolding journey—escorting them to various spaces, checking in at tables, making key announcements, and sharing poetic narratives throughout the night.

The event offered a deeply immersive experience with unexpected creative activations such as nude painting sessions and clay workshops. Guests also enjoyed an exclusive first look at a private-collection exhibition on the top floor.

Entertainment was woven throughout the evening, including roving opera performances during dinner and Dada-inspired contemporary dancers animating the spaces during the after-party.
